    Scope of Financial Crime Allegations

    Financial crimes often involve complex transactions, tax issues, or alleged manipulation of markets and investors.

    Common cases include:

    1. Securities fraud and insider trading
    2. Money laundering and structuring
    3. Tax evasion and failure to file
    4. Ponzi schemes and investment scams
    5. Bank fraud and mortgage fraud

    Critical Issues in Financial Investigations

    • Tracing funds through complex financial records
    • Negotiating with IRS, SEC, or FINRA investigators
    • International banking, OFAC, and currency controls
    • Coordinating parallel civil, tax, or regulatory cases
    • Determining restitution and loss calculations

    Defense Approaches

    Lawyers analyze financial data, engage forensic accountants, and challenge intent to defraud.

    • Reviewing bank records, ledgers, and trading data
    • Presenting alternative explanations for transactions
    • Negotiating cooperation or deferred prosecution agreements
    • Protecting clients during proffer sessions and interviews
    • Arguing loss calculations to reduce sentencing exposure

    When to Hire a Financial Crimes Lawyer

    Retain counsel as soon as you learn of government interest, grand jury subpoenas, or suspicious activity reports tied to your accounts.

    • IRS or SEC agents contacted you
    • Banks froze accounts or filed SARs
    • International transactions are under scrutiny
    • You are negotiating with regulators or compliance teams
    • You may be asked to testify before a grand jury

    Cost Expectations

    Complex financial cases demand significant attorney time and expert analysis, often across multiple jurisdictions.

    • Retainers reflecting multi-agency investigations
    • Forensic accounting and data-analytics expenses
    • International travel or translation services
    • Compliance monitors or restitution management
